Today in Italy is celebrated Fat Thursday, the traditional Catholic feast marking the last Thursday before Lent and Carnevale. Carnevale is the most colorful and playful period of the year, when everyone wears a costume or a mask, and celebrates in the streets with festive parades, allegoric floats, coriandoli (paper confetti), stelle filanti (paper streamers) and delicious sweet treats such as Chiacchiere. Chiacchiere are sweet crisp pastries, deep-fried, sprinkled with powdered sugar and are known by different names depending on the regions in which they are prepared :

Lombardy : chiacchiere

Bologna : sfrappole

Tuscany : cenci

Rome : frappe

Tentino Alto Adige & Friuli Venezia Giulia : crostoli 

Liguria & Piedmont : bugie

Sardinia : meraviglias

No matter how we call them, Chiacchiere are simply delicious.
